The compact N-381 linear actuators are ideal drives and micro manipulators e.g. for biotechnology and nanotechnology applications. Rapid accelerations, velocities of 10 mm/s and forces up to 10 N enable high-dynamics and throughput for automation tasks. The PiezoWalk® drive principle allows long travel ranges and fast oscillations of 7 µm amplitude with frequencies up to several 100 Hz. This "analog mode" can be used to provide rapid acceleration, e.g. in cell penetration applications, or smooth motion for dynamic laser tuning or even for active damping of oscillations. Two models are available: The N-381.3A model is equipped with a high-resolution position sensor, allowing sub-micrometer repeatability in closed-loop operation. The N-381.30 open-loop version is intended for high precision applications where the absolute position is not important or is controlled by an external loop (video, laser, quadcell, etc.).
